The International Marlin and Tuna Fishing Tournament enters its second year this year with last year’s competition drawing thousands of participants from all over the world including the United States and Canada. This year’s tournament begins on July 10th and ends on July 12th, 2008, featuring a first place purse of USD$10,000 in each category for marlin and tuna catches. The Tournament will be held at the new Marina Riviera Nayarit in La Cruz de Huanacaxtle. Riviera Nayarit is fast becoming known as one of the best fishing destinations in the Americas as its coast offers an abundance of catches like marlin and tuna, as well as top game fish such as sailfish, mahi mahi, grouper, red snapper and wahoo.

The tuna season extends from May to October and the marlin season extends from July through February including blue marlin, black marlin and striped marlin. Whether participating in the tournament or just enjoying a vacation in Riviera Nayarit, there is so much to see and do. Things you should see and do include: visiting Bucerías, a fishing town with cobblestone street known for its seaside restaurants, bars and tiny shops; Islas Marietas, an island wildlife sanctuary, home to many endangered bird species as well as rare coral reefs; Sayulita which is internationally recognized for its outstanding surfing, oceanside restaurants and cafes, luxurious villas and spas; and Rincón de Guayabitos which has been described as the “Hidden Pearl” among the beaches of Nayarit, featuring magnificent diving and fishing spots.

Riviera Nayarit is also popular for its excellent golf and superb spas. There are four world class golf courses in Riviera Nayarit including El Tigre Club De Golf, Flamingos Golf Club and the Mayan Palace Golf Club (all in Nuevo Vallarta). Luxury spas include: Grand Velas Spa at the Grand Velas All Suites and Spa Resort in Nuevo Vallarta, Tatewari Spa at Villas del Palmar and the Apuane Spa at the Four Seasons Resort Punta Mita.

About Riviera Nayarit: Riviera Nayarit is Mexico’s newest travel destination stretching along 100 miles of pristine Pacific coast framed by spectacular mountains to the north of renowned Puerto Vallarta.

Mostly undeveloped, the destination extends from the resorts of Nuevo Vallarta to the historic, colonial town of San Blas, including exclusive Punta Mita and the spectacular Banderas Bay. The region features luxury resorts and eco-tourism boutique hotels, world-renowned surfing, four professional golf courses, rare native wildlife including sea turtles and tropical birds, mountain and island adventures, shopping for local artwork and traditional Huichol handicrafts, charming fishing towns and miles of serene beaches.
